JB, I usually do this on the fly and tell them but it is not in writing. You do however bring up a very good point. Telling someone you are bumping them up and them seeing the value in $$$ is 2 different things, even if they do not look at it until they leave. The dollar value may hit home with them at that time.
I have been more leary in upgrading people lately. I have seen where I upgraded someone just because I could. Then next time they book, they book the same room as before, and seem a little disappointed when they get the room they actually booked, silently they were expecting another free upgrade..
We had a couple here like that. Actually 2 couples. One GOPO who kept bringing up to us how nice the PO's were because they upgraded their room for free. OK, buddy, what's your point? YOU booked the most expensive room, there ARE no upgrades from there.
The other was in-state coming for a dr's appt very early in the morning. They arrived and it was obvious she could not climb the stairs. We were empty at that point, so we gave them the best room for the small room price, plus, I think we had discounted even the small room price, so quite the deal.
Next time they wanted to rebook, they wanted the big room in season for the off season small room price (now we're talking about $75 difference). We said we couldn't and they were very hurt. And they didn't book.
We now have a couple here for 5 days who booked the smallest room because it was all we had open for all 5 days. I was going to move them after the first night, but the other room they could have had filled up. They seem perfectly ok and every day leave a thank you note & $2 for the housekeeper.
